In most Honda CR-Vs, the timing chain is designed to last the life of the engine—often well beyond 200,000 miles—so long as you keep up with regular oil changes and address issues promptly. Replacements are rare and typically occur only if tensioners, guides, or oil issues wear out the system.
Understanding how timing chains work in the CR-V
Timing chains connect the crankshaft to the camshafts and synchronize the opening and closing of the engine’s valves. Unlike timing belts, chains are metal and rely on engine oil to stay lubricated. Key wear points are the chain itself, the guides that route it, and the tensioner that keeps it properly tight. Because the system operates under load whenever the engine runs, proper oil maintenance is essential to maximize longevity.

Typical lifespan and real-world expectations
For most CR-V models, the timing chain is designed to last the life of the engine, with many owners reporting 150,000 to 250,000 miles or more without a chain-related failure. Real-world longevity depends on maintenance, driving conditions, and the health of the lubrication system. Regular oil changes, using the right grade and viscosity, are the most important factor in preventing premature wear to chains and tensioners.

Warning signs of timing chain wear or failure
Timely recognition of wear can prevent costly damage. The following signs may indicate a problem with the timing chain, guides, or tensioner.
- Rattling, tapping, or slapping noises from the engine, especially on startup or at cold temperatures
- Rough running, misfires, or loss of power that seems to correlate with engine timing
- Check Engine Light with codes related to variable valve timing or misfire
- Oil leaks near the timing chain area or a sudden drop in oil pressure
- Engine mis-timing or failure to start after long periods of poor maintenance
If you notice these signs, have the vehicle inspected urgently. A failed timing chain can cause severe engine damage, especially if the chain jumps a tooth and valves and pistons collide.
Maintenance practices to maximize timing chain longevity
Proactive maintenance is the best defense against premature wear. The following practices help ensure the timing chain remains in good condition across the CR-V’s lifespan.
- Follow the manufacturer’s oil change schedule precisely, using the recommended oil grade (often 0W-20 synthetic for newer CR-V models) and a quality filter. Typical intervals range from about 5,000 miles (conventional oil) to 7,500–10,000 miles (synthetic oil), depending on the model and driving conditions.
- Keep the oil level full and monitor for leaks. Low or dirty oil accelerates wear on the chain guides and tensioners.
- Address any oil leaks promptly and never run the engine with low oil pressure or low oil volume.
- Respond quickly to unusual engine noises or performance changes. Early inspection can prevent more serious (and costly) damage.
- Have a qualified technician inspect the timing chain area at recommended service intervals, especially on high-mileage examples or vehicles with a history of harsh service.
- Avoid aggressive driving that spikes engine load and temperatures, which can increase wear on all internal components, including the chain system.
Following these steps can help maximize the life of a CR-V timing chain and minimize the likelihood of unexpected failures.
